make sure your main fuse going to the amp is good.....youmay have blown it, and the amp is trying to come on using the remote wire...

ive seen it happen before....glass fuse was blown but you couldnt see where the fuse blew by looking at it....the amp would come on for a second , try to play , then just cut off and on. over and over again...changed the fuse and the amp worked great...

 
That makes sense. I have not messed with too many of kicker's amps. Some of them just control the base of a NPN that controls the base of a PNP which supplies B+ voltage to the SMPS controller and etc.

 
Sounds like a couple of things.
Could be DC bias detection. Are your speakers/subs moving out/in and when it turns off it moves back to center?

i checked the amp fuses and the fuse under the hood, just gotta check the fuse that goes to my dry cell, maybe i blew it somehow.

its wierd cause it was working fine before the other day. all i did was remove my 2nd amp wires and hook it back up. must of did something.

 
problem solved....check the fuse between the truck battery and the shuriken dry cell and it was blown, replaced and good as new....
